Bahamas Premier Girls Fastpitch is an elite youth softball ecosystem committed to revolutionizing softball in The Bahamas while developing the next generation of Bahamian girls on and off the field.
Founded by former Bahamas National Softball Team member and professional instructor Shawnté Curtis, Bahamas Premier exists to raise the national standard of softball development, structure, coaching, competition, and opportunity.

Founder and Former Bahamas National Softball Team Athlete
Shawnté Curtis is a former Bahamas National Softball Team member, professional instructor, and coach dedicated to transforming the future of softball in The Bahamas.
Her journey began at just five years old at Freedom Farm Baseball League, where she played baseball because opportunities for girls in softball were limited. Often the only girl on her team and in tournaments, Shawnté experienced firsthand the lack of early access and structure available to young female athletes.
After transitioning to softball at age 12, she represented The Bahamas on both the Junior and Senior National Teams and later gained coaching experience across recreational, high school, travel ball, and professional training environments.
Shawnté graduated Summa Cum Laude with a degree in Sport Administration and has spent the past three years coaching, mentoring, and developing athletes in the U.S. and The Bahamas.
Today, through Bahamas Premier Girls Fastpitch, Shawnté is building the kind of structured, intentional, opportunity-driven softball ecosystem she wishes existed for young Bahamian girls.

Bahamas Premier is built on intentional development pillars–from how we train to how we structure each session–to help athletes grow on and off the field.
We prioritize overall athletic development–speed, coordination, strength, and body control–as the foundation for long-term success in the game.
We maintain appropriate player-to-coach ratios to ensure each athlete receives the attention, repetitions, and feedback needed to improve.
Our sessions are planned with purpose. Small groups, station work, smooth transitions, and clear practice structure help maximize every minute on the field.
We are committed to developing coaches just as intentionally as we develop players, strengthening the future of softball instruction in The Bahamas.
We create an environment where every girl feels safe and supported–surrounded by a community that invests in her growth on and off the field.
